The median home value in Ingalls, IN is $244,392. This is higher than the county median home value of $93,800. The national median home value is $219,700. The average price of homes sold in Ingalls, IN is $244,392. Approximately 74.97% of Ingalls homes are owned, compared to 20.45% rented, while 4.58% are vacant. Ingalls, Indiana has a population of 2,388. Ingalls is more family-centric than the surrounding county with 40.96% of the households containing married families with children. The county average for households married with children is 26.68%.
The median household income in Ingalls, Indiana is $45,577. The median household income for the surrounding county is $45,432 compared to the national median of $57,652. The median age of people living in Ingalls is 31.1 years.
The average high temperature in July is 84.2 degrees, with an average low temperature in January of 18.7 degrees. The average rainfall is approximately 41.5 inches per year, with 19.5 inches of snow per year.
